According to Deadline, Matt Damon is going to once again return to the role of Jason Bourne. Universal Pictures is reportedly in process of making a deal not only with Damon but also with director Paul Greengrass to reunite for their third film together in The Bourne Identity series. Neither Univeral nor Damon and Greengrass' reps would comment on the story.

According to Deadline's sources, the new Bourne film with Matt Damon would go into production as the next Bourne film in the series. Universal had already laid claim to the release date of July 16, 2016 for an untitled Bourne film, which most had believed would star Jeremy Renner and be directed by Fast & Furious' Justin Lin.

However, the Renner spinoff sequel would reportedly be pushed back, and Damon's return to the series would take precedence. The Renner series would remain in development and be released at a later date. Universal sees having both Damon and Renner as the best of two worlds for continuing to build the Bourne franchise. Lin is signed on to direct the second season of True Detective, so it would also allow him time to focus on that series.
